Příkazy do konzole v návodech

Aleš Bobek

Příkazy do konzole v návodech
« kdy: 16. 03. 2015, 13:21:58 »
Zdravím,
mám připomínku ohledně stylu psaní příkazů do konzole v návodech(postupech), jestli je nutné, aby před každým příkazem byl hash #, který znemožňuje jednoduché kopírování(v případě Windows trojklikem).

Na jiných webech je to tak běžné. Vždy je samozřejmě možné text opsat, ale je to přeci jen pohodlnější :).

Díky


Pavels

Re:Příkazy do konzole v návodech
« Odpověď #1 kdy: 16. 03. 2015, 13:47:31 »
Uplne ti rozumim, proc te # otravuje pri kopirovani. Nekde zase cpou >>> tam, kde je pythoni kod. To me taky vytaci.
Chytrejsi weby si ale tohle pohlidaji, viz treba http://code.activestate.com

Johny

Re:Příkazy do konzole v návodech
« Odpověď #2 kdy: 16. 03. 2015, 13:59:28 »
Tak # je tam, kde se prikaz spousti pod rootem, $ kde pod jinym uzivatelem, nekdy na to mdocela zalezi :)

Re:Příkazy do konzole v návodech
« Odpověď #3 kdy: 16. 03. 2015, 17:21:12 »
copy/paste do konzole, zvlast rootovsky, neni dobry napad.



Boban

Re:Příkazy do konzole v návodech
« Odpověď #5 kdy: 17. 03. 2015, 13:20:24 »
copy/paste do konzole, zvlast rootovsky, neni dobry napad.

Chápu, může být zobrazeno něco jiného, než co bude zkopírováno.

samalama

Re:Příkazy do konzole v návodech
« Odpověď #6 kdy: 17. 03. 2015, 18:48:23 »
copy/paste do konzole, zvlast rootovsky, neni dobry napad.

v pripade, ze copy-paster netusi, co tam zadava, tak je v podstate jedno, ci to opise alebo copy-pastne... :)

Fantomas

Re:Příkazy do konzole v návodech
« Odpověď #7 kdy: 17. 03. 2015, 20:55:52 »
Viz johny, je to hlavne informace, jestli se musi poustet s root pravy. Nektere prikazy nejdou pod user vubec pustit, tato informace predejde zbytecnemu problemu s resenim jiz vyresenych otazek. Sam obcas pisu navody, tak vim, jak tato prkotina zjednodusuje zbytecne vysvetlovani.

Lucas

Re:Příkazy do konzole v návodech
« Odpověď #8 kdy: 18. 03. 2015, 08:02:31 »
Tohle by se dalo jednoduše řešit CSS pseudotřídou :before. Tedy za předpokladu, že každý řádek bude obalený nějakým elementem(například při použití zvýrazňovače), což ovšem není tenhle případ.

Můžeš si ale vypomoct krátkým uživatelským skriptem:

Kód: [Vybrat]
$('<style>')
    .html('pre .row.root:before {content: "# ";}')
    .appendTo('head');
$('pre').each(function() {
    $pre = $(this);
    rows = $pre.text().split('\n');
    $pre.text('');
    rows.forEach(function(row) {
        $row = $('<div class="row">');
        if (row.startsWith('# ')) {
            $row.addClass('root');
            row = row.slice(2);
        }
        $row.text(row).appendTo($pre);
    });
});

Hashe na začátcích řádků se sice zobrazí, ale nezkopírují.

Lucas

Re:Příkazy do konzole v návodech
« Odpověď #9 kdy: 18. 03. 2015, 08:12:02 »
Sorry, už jsem zdegenerovaný CoffeeScriptem, u všech proměnných si doplň var.